Transaction 69ffba918f366ccaa5c8758fd11fe98bbc39b566dcb2687044659171c596be2d
1 Input
2 Outputs
- 69ffba918f366ccaa5c8758fd11fe98bbc39b566dcb2687044659171c596be2d:0
- 69ffba918f366ccaa5c8758fd11fe98bbc39b566dcb2687044659171c596be2d:1
value 329749
address 1KFQhJTQMEb34xzfwRYkkpFjdacm5PLjvh
value 756635
address 17AGjRSz4wL2H3pg2ssijpENdm3Re7HKqA